A Pulse Induction (PI) metal detector is a type of metal detector that uses short, powerful pulses of electromagnetic energy to detect buried metal objects. Unlike other types of metal detectors, PI detectors are known for their ability to penetrate deeply into highly mineralized or conductive soils, making them ideal for gold prospecting and searching in challenging environments.
Here's a more detailed explanation:
How it works:
Pulsed Electromagnetic Field:
PI detectors send out short, high-energy pulses of current through a coil of wire. These pulses create a magnetic field.
Magnetic Field Collapse:
When the pulse is turned off, the magnetic field collapses rapidly.
Target Response:
If a metal object is nearby, the collapsing magnetic field induces an electrical current in the target. This current then creates its own magnetic field, which the detector senses as a return signal.
Decay Time Measurement:
